This document discusses intelligent packaging systems. It describes indicators, radio frequency identification tags (RFID), and sensors that can be incorporated into packaging to monitor food quality and safety. Indicators detect conditions like temperature, oxygen levels, and freshness through color changes. RFID tags allow for product tracing. Sensors can detect pathogens, toxins, and gases. The case study describes developing intelligent films that change color based on pH levels using chitosan and anthocyanins, showing potential to monitor food quality during storage and transport. In conclusion, intelligent packaging benefits food safety and quality but further research is needed to reduce costs and develop models translating sensor data into quality metrics.
